I noticed some earlier people in this thread discussing whether lexington would be too boring for their tastes. I went to undergrad in a moderately sized city and I am so far really enjoying my experience here (and I am in the middle of exams so that is saying something). The law school does a great job of planning great events for us nearly every weekend with free booze/ food, and I can assure you that these events end up being far from boring.
I also can assure you that I have quite possibly the best group of classmates ever. Everyone is great, even now when the pressure is really at its worst.
